Manic Predicts: Top Fashion brands to look out for in 2023

As the fashion industry continues to evolve and adapt to changing consumer preferences, there are several brands that are poised to make a big impact in 2023. From sustainable and ethical fashion to streetwear and high-end luxury, here are some fashion brands to keep an eye on in the coming year.



1. A-COLD-WALL*

Founded by British designer Samuel Ross in 2015, A-COLD-WALL* has quickly become one of the most sought-after streetwear brands in the world. Known for its unique aesthetic and use of innovative materials, the brand has collaborated with the likes of Nike and Converse to create limited-edition sneakers and apparel. In 2023, expect A-COLD-WALL* to continue to push the boundaries of streetwear and elevate the category to new heights.



2. Telfar

Telfar is a New York-based fashion brand that has gained a cult following in recent years thanks to its gender-neutral and inclusive designs. The brand's signature shopping bag, which features a simple yet bold design, has become an icon in the fashion world and is often sold out within minutes of being restocked. In 2023, Telfar is expected to continue to grow its fan base and expand its offerings beyond its signature bag.



3. Bottega Veneta

Under the creative direction of Matthieu Blazy, Bottega Veneta has experienced a resurgence in recent years, with its woven leather bags and shoes becoming must-haves for fashion insiders. In 2023, expect the brand to continue to innovate and push the boundaries of luxury fashion, with new designs that blend classic Italian craftsmanship with a modern sensibility.



4. Stella McCartney

Stella McCartney has long been a leader in sustainable and ethical fashion, using innovative materials and production methods to create designs that are both beautiful and environmentally friendly. In 2023, expect the brand to continue to be at the forefront of the sustainable fashion movement, with new collections that showcase the latest in eco-friendly design.



5. Pyer Moss

Founded by designer Kerby Jean-Raymond in 2013, Pyer Moss has become known for its socially conscious designs that address issues of race, identity, and justice. In 2023, expect the brand to continue to use fashion as a platform for social change, with collections that challenge the status quo and push for a more equitable and just society.
